Hygge (2017)

Hygge (2017) poster

The film is about an Irish and a Syrian family living as neighbours in a community housing project. The story follows the friendship developed by a young Irish boy, Paddy, and a young Syrian girl, Aamira. Their innocence breaks down barriers and brings them together as best friends.
